I find the timbre and harmony of the beginning really interesting, so even it’s minimalistic I don’t find it boring at all, especially you add instruments in each cycle and change the timbre! Like in around 1:58 it’s lighter with pizzicato strings. in 2:40 there is first real change of harmony and I find it real fresh that you introduce some pentatonic in D here with the flutes and oboes! Dry nice orchestral colour here. You slow down the pace at the end which is very smart. Ending it in F sharp aeolian gives a bare and sad feeling for the exploration. I really enjoy this one.
